

Instant Pot Beef & Potato Soup

Ingredients
1 pound ground beef
5 potatoes cubed
1 1/2 tsp garlic powder
1 tsp onion powder
1 onion chopped
3 stalks celery chopped
3 tablespoons parsley (fresh) If you are using dried parsley, use less.
3 cubes Knorr chicken bouillon
6 cups water
12 oz sharp cheddar cheese grated
1 cup half and half
2 tablespoons cool water
1 tablespoon corn starch
salt and pepper to taste
Directions
-
Using the saute setting, brown the beef.
-
Toss in the onions and celery and cook until the onions are translucent.
-
Add the bouillon, 6 cups water, potatoes, garlic powder, & onion powder.
-
Using the pressure cook feature, cook for 10 minutes.
-
When steam has released, remove lid.
-
Add the half and half, parsley and cheddar and stir well. Turn on the saute feature.
-
Add the corn starch and 2 tablespoons of water. Cook until the mixture thickens a bit more. If you prefer a thicker soup, add more of the corn starch and water mixture.
-
Add salt and pepper to taste.
-
Top with extra cheese and/or sour cream to serve.
